ci: make the upower cross build actually work

The upower steps were added after the last green release and had never
run successfully — the Jul 13 edge release contains no upower package at
all. Six defects, each hiding the next, found by reproducing the steps on
the runner:

- SOUVERAINE_AARCH64_SYSROOT was exported in the binaries step, not this
  one; steps do not share environment, so the pkg-config wrapper fell back
  to /usr/aarch64-linux-gnu and glib was not found.
- c_link_args had --sysroot but no -L, so ld could not resolve the bare
  paths inside the sysroot linker scripts (libm, libmvec).
- PKG_CONFIG_LIBDIR covered only lib/pkgconfig; udev.pc lives in
  share/pkgconfig. Fixed in the wrapper, which overrides the caller.
- introspection ran g-ir-scanner against an aarch64 build and failed;
  disabled for the cross build only (the phone ships no UPowerGlib
  typelib and quickshell's UPower module is native Qt).
- gtk-doc/man default on, but gtkdoc-scan is absent from the runner, so
  the x86_64 native build would have failed at the same point.
- the aarch64 sanity check tested usr/lib/upowerd; it installs to
  usr/libexec/upowerd, so the check failed even on a good build.

Verified on archdev: aarch64 56/56 targets, upowerd is aarch64, built
from 628283f with the charge-type fix; x86_64 58/58 native.
